There is definitely something you have in common with people with aspergers. The way you described your flapping is pretty much spot on with what myself and other Aspies have described. I will sometimes injure myself because I do it so often when I get excited.

I also found it interesting how you said you get mad at your mother based on conversations you have in your head, as I often react to my inner dialogue by laughing out loud or making facial expressions, which is confusing to other's since they don't usually react so directly to their inner thoughts. This seems to be a trait of people who are introverted, as the brains of introverts are wired to respond more to their inner-world than to the outer world.
